多相插值滤波器将一组 N 个原滤波器系数 ,映射为P个多相子滤波器, 转换公式与式3-1相同: 每个新的输入采样x(n)同时并行送入P个多相子滤波器,同时得到P个输出采样,每个多相子滤波器输出一个采样送到滤波器输出端口,输出端口从第一个多相子滤波器开始依次选择多相子滤波器的输出。由于输入采样是同时并行送入每个多相子滤波器的,因此多相插值滤波器的输出采样速率是输入数据采
转载
2023-11-27 22:55:51
0阅读
## 多相插值滤波器及其应用
在数字信号处理领域,插值滤波器是非常重要的一种工具。多相插值滤波器广泛应用于音频处理、图片缩放和信号的采样率转换等场景。本文将介绍多相插值滤波器的基本概念,并提供Python代码示例。
### 什么是多相插值滤波器?
多相插值滤波器(Multirate Interpolation Filter)是一种对输入信号进行插值处理的滤波器。在信号处理的背景下,它的主要功
多相滤波器MATLAB仿真---抽取&插值目录前言一、什么是多相滤波器?二、抽取1.不考虑滤波器延时下的抽取2.考虑滤波器延时下的抽取三、插值参考文献总结前言 语音信号多相滤波器是我上学期末做的一个课设,过了许久,在此仅仅简单记录一下,以特定的D值和I值展示一下操作过程,不贴出通用函数,希望对正在学习该内容的伙伴有所帮助。本文以工程实现的角度浅谈多相滤波器,由于数字
转载
2023-09-22 07:03:55
323阅读
多相滤波是,按照相位均匀划分把数字滤波器的系统函数H(z)分解成若干个具有不同相位的组,形成多个分支,在每个分支上实现滤波。
采用多相滤波结构,可利用多个阶数较低的滤波来实现原本阶数较高的滤波,而且每个分支滤波器处理的数据速率仅为原数据速率的I/D,这为工程上高速率实时
信号处理提供了实现途径
多相滤波结构信道化接收机的多相滤波结构
数字信道化算法原理。 算法原理如下图
上篇博文:【 FPGA 】FIR 滤波器之多相抽取器(Polyphase Decimator),这篇博文和它有点类似,为多相插值器。多相插值滤波器将一组 N 个原滤波器系数 ,映射为P个多相子滤波器,转换的公式上上篇博文:多相抽取器使用的公式一致,如下:i从0到 P-1.图3-27显示了多相插值滤波器结构,该选项实现了计算效率高的1-to-P插值滤波器。每个新的输入采样...
原创
2022-04-14 16:06:20
1117阅读
1评论
多相插值滤波器将一组 N 个原滤波器系数 ,映射为P个多相子滤波器,转换的公式上上篇博文:多相抽取器使用的公式一致,如下:i从0到 P-1.图3-27显示了多相插值滤波器结构,该选项实现了计算效率高的1-to-P插值滤波器。每个新的输入采样...
原创
2021-08-20 13:36:16
1598阅读
对于信号在时域上的显示可以在chipscope亦或者直接在示波器上进行观察,但是对于涉及到频域的问题,例如频谱,插值,频域补偿等需要用到滤波等运算则最好在matlab上运行。 下面是近期一些常用的matlab命令的整理以及总结:首先是对于数据的输入,对于我而言目前常用的两种已经能够满足需求,一种是通过chipscope抓取过来另存为.mat的格式:v1 = cell2mat(struct2cell
转载
2023-10-15 18:03:43
113阅读
在现代电子系统中,到处都可以看到数字信号处理( DSP )的应用,从MP3播放器、数码相机到手机。DSP设计人员的工具箱的支柱之一是有限脉冲响应( FIR )滤波器。FIR滤波器越长(有大量的抽头),滤波器的响应越好。然而这里有折衷的情况,由于大量的抽头增加了对逻辑的需求、增加了计算的复杂性,增加了功耗,以及可能引起饱和/溢出。 多相技术可以用于实现滤波器,拥有与传统FIR滤波器可比的结果,
滤波器主要有低通滤波器、高通滤波器和带通滤波器三种,按照电路工作原理又可分为无源和有源滤波器两大类。低通滤波器电感阻止高频信号通过而允许低频信号通过,电容的特性却相反。信号能够通过电感的滤波器、或者通过电容连接到地的滤波器对于低频信号的衰减要比高频信号小,称为低通滤波器。低通滤波器原理很简单,它就是利用电容通高频阻低频、电感通低频阻高频的原理。对于需要截止的高频,利用电容吸收电感、阻碍的方法不使它
转载
2024-01-13 12:43:36
56阅读
多项抽取滤波器的基本原理:根据等式3-1,将一组N个原型滤波器系数映射到M个多相子滤波器中,映射关系如下:图3-26显示了多相抽取滤波器选项,它实现了计算效率高的M-to-1多相抽取滤波器。 如上图,多相子滤波器从第M个开始逐个以输出采样x(n)作为输入,到第一个输入后完成一轮循环,即将M个采样分别送入M个多相子滤波器后,开始得到输出,输出为M个多相子滤波器输出之和,输出采...
原创
2021-08-20 13:53:26
1669阅读
一、摘要本次一共做了11个滤波器实验,包括: 1.限幅滤波器 2.中位值滤波器 3.递推中位值滤波器 4.算数平均值滤波器 5.递推算数平均数滤波器 6.中位值平均滤波器 7.限幅平均滤波器 8.一阶滞后滤波器 9.加权递推平均滤波器 10. 消抖滤波器 11.限幅消抖滤波器网上常见的有10个滤波器,第三个递推中位值滤波器由自己小改设计二、简单常规滤波器1.限幅滤波器1.1 操作方法根据经验判断两
转载
2023-09-02 11:31:52
221阅读
多项抽取滤波器的基本原理:根据等式3-1,将一组N个原型滤波器系数映射到M个多相子滤波器中,映射关系如下:图3-26显示了多相抽取滤波器选项,它实现了计算效率高的M-to-1多相抽取滤波器。 如上图,多相子滤波器从第M个开始逐个以输出采样x(n)作为输入,到第一个输入后完成一轮循环,即将M个采样分别送入M个多相子滤波器后,开始得到输出,输出为M个多相子滤波器输出之和,输出采...
原创
2022-04-14 16:08:34
533阅读
平滑(模糊)是一种简单而经常使用的图像处理操作,意图是减少噪声最常见的滤波器是线性的,输出像素的值为g(i,j)被确定为输入像素值的加权和。h(k,l)为滤波器的系数。归一化框过滤器每个输出像素是内核邻居的均值内核为:高斯滤波器 可能是最有用的过滤器(虽然不是最快的)。高斯滤波是通过将输入数组中的每个点与高斯核进行卷积来完成的,然后将它们相加以产生输出数组。只
上半年毕设的时候接触了卡尔曼滤波器,用matlab实现了该过程,尝试在一个课后作业中用三维度矩阵来存储变量的方式,结构似乎更好理解,记录一下分析的过程。可以查看中的卡尔曼滤波器部分,有一些更详细的解读。假如有一块电阻,你不知道它的阻值是多少,你想通过多次测量电压和电流值,从而用定义法求出来它的阻值大小,测量结果如下表所示:Current (A)Voltage (V)0.21.230.31.380.
在使用Python进行信号处理过程中,利用 scipy.signal.filtfilt()可以快速帮助实现信号的滤波。1.函数的介绍(1).滤波函数scipy.signal.filtfilt(b, a, x, axis=-1, padtype='odd', padlen=None, method='pad', irlen=None)输入参数:b: 滤波器的分子系数向量a: 滤波器的分母系数向量x:
转载
2023-08-13 13:40:03
691阅读
文章目录1.高斯滤波器2.高斯函数讲解(1)高斯函数(2)参数详解(3)高斯函数具体实现过程(3)那这里的sigmaX,sigmaY,ksize是怎么实现卷积并且对图像进行滤波的呢?(1)为什么要使用sigmaX和sigmaY呢?(2)卷积核(权重矩阵)中的值具体计算3.代码实战(1)当sigma=0.0时,随着ksize的不同,平滑的效果(2)当设置sigma的值不为0的时候,随着sigma增
转载
2023-11-06 09:32:30
66阅读
scipy Matlab-style IIR 滤波器设计上(Butterworth\Chebyshev type I \Chebyshev type II )各种滤波接口滤波器接口含义butter(N, Wn[, btype, analog, output, fs])设计Butterworth模拟和数字滤波器buttord(wp, ws, gpass, gstop[, analog, fs])自动
基于scipy模块使用Python实现简单滤波处理作用:去除干扰信号1. 低通滤波:去除高于某一阈值频率的信号;'lowpass'2. 高通滤波:去除低于某一频率的信号;'highpass'3. 带通滤波:类似低通高通的结合保留中间频率信号;'bandpass'4. 带阻滤波器:低通高通的结合只是过滤掉的是中间部分;'bandstop'一、滤波器构造函数:s
转载
2023-07-05 19:34:18
1103阅读
scipy.signal.ellip 椭圆滤波器scipy.signal.ellip(N, rp, rs, Wn, btype='low',analog=False, output='ba', fs=None)[source]Elliptic (Cauer) digital and analog filterdesign. Design an Nth-order digital or analog
转载
2023-08-07 16:41:29
324阅读
前言本节将要介绍OpenCV 提供的三种不同的梯度滤波器,或者说高通滤波器:Sobel,Scharr 和 Laplacian。总的来说:Sobel,Scharr 其实就是求一阶或二阶导数。Scharr 是对 Sobel(使用小的卷积核求解求解梯度角度时)的优化。而Laplacian 是求二阶导数。一、Sobel算子其API如下:dst = cv2.Sobel(src, ddepth, dx, dy
转载
2023-12-04 22:56:26
64阅读